Wire Mesh Applications: From Construction to Art
Wire mesh presents a surprisingly broad range of applications, extending far beyond its traditional role in construction and infrastructure. While it remains a crucial component for reinforcing concrete structures, fencing, and sieving materials, wire mesh has also emerged as an unexpected material in the realm of art and design. Artists employ the inherent texture and durability of wire mesh to create intricate sculptures,wall installations, and even wearable pieces. The malleability of wire mesh allows for free-form shapes, while its open structure creates a sense of airiness. From utilitarian applications to artistic expressions, wire mesh continues to adapt as a adaptable material that bridges the gap between practicality and creativity.
A Must-Have for Every Need
Wire mesh is a incredibly popular material with a wide range of purposes. Its strength and adaptability make it an ideal choice for countless tasks. From manufacturing, to separation, wire mesh plays a vital role in our daily lives. Whether you need a durable guard or a precise filter, there is a type of wire mesh to meet your specific needs.
- Some common uses for wire mesh include:
- Infrastructure: Reinforcing concrete, creating security barriers
- Manufacturing: Conveying materials, protecting equipment
- Farming: Protecting crops from pests, making animal cages
- Purification: Removing impurities from liquids or gases
